Job Description

Are you a detail-oriented financial professional looking to make an impact in the heart of Music City?

We are seeking a Senior Accountant to join our dynamic finance team at Metro Financial Solutions. In this pivotal role, you will take ownership of our financial reporting, manage complex accounts, and ensure full compliance with GAAP standards while contributing to our strategic growth.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Oversee the monthly and annual accounting close processes, ensuring timely and accurate financial statements.
  • Prepare and analyze complex financial reports, variance analysis, and budgets for senior leadership.
  • Manage general ledger activities, reconciliations, and inter-company transactions.
  • Assist in the preparation of tax filings and ensure compliance with federal and state regulations.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to improve financial processes and internal controls.
  • Mentor junior accounting staff and provide guidance on complex accounting issues.

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Accounting or Finance (CPA or CMA certification is a strong plus).
  • Minimum of 5 years of progressive experience in corporate accounting or public accounting.
  • Proficiency in advanced Excel functions, ERP systems (SAP/NetSuite preferred), and accounting software (QuickBooks, Sage).
  • Strong understanding of GAAP, tax laws, and financial regulations.
  • Excellent analytical skills with a keen eye for detail and accuracy.
  • Strong verbal and written communication skills.
